## Deploying the Gatewick Proctor Queue

Deploys are pretty painless: push to main, wait for the pipeline, then watch the queue drain dashboard for five minutes. If candidates pile up mid-exam, roll back first and ask questions later — the queue replays safely. Everything the workers care about lives in one config block, shown here for reference.

settings of bafof-yagef:
JOROX_PIN=8740
JOROX_TENANT=pelox
JOROX_METRICS_HOST=metrics.jorox.qorvelworks.internal
JOROX_SEAL=seal_c78f63c1
JOROX_STANDBY_TEAM=norax

## Env Vars for Plugin Authors — Dataloader Edition

Quick context: Hatchling's GraphQL API used to fire one query per child node (the classic N+1 mess). As of v3.1 we batch everything through a dataloader layer, and plugins that resolve fields must opt into it via `HATCHLING_BATCH_RESOLVERS=true`. You'll also want `BATCH_WINDOW_MS=10` unless you have a good reason. Finally, your plugin needs to authenticate against the batching gateway, so set its credential on this line of your `.env`:

secret setting of yagef-baweg: RELAY_SECRET29=cb53deb59a49ed54d9f43599b54ca

Handover note — evening shift

Hi Merral,

Quick one before I head off: the cool box with the Darnley Reservoir water samples is in the chiller by the roller door. Lab needs them first thing, so put them on the earliest run you've got — they're time-sensitive and the bottles are logged already. Courier hand-over goes like this:

handover note for bajog-tawig: the lamion quenael courier leaves the wendor ledger at gate 1289 under passcode 760784

Subject: Quickstore 4.2 — bloom filter now fronts the KV layer

Plugin authors: starting with this release, Quickstore places a bloom filter ahead of the key-value store. Negative lookups return faster; false positives fall through safely. No API changes are required on your side. Verify your plugin against the staging build referenced below.

session token of fahif-tadup = htk3_9c7